The Libertarian: “Libertarianism and Terrorism”

from The Libertarian · host Hoover Institution

Is Rand Paul’s approach to the rise of ISIS in the Middle East even worse than President Obama’s? Richard Epstein examines that question and other as he argues that Libertarians should avoid clinging to noninterventionism when it comes to the threat of terrorism.
